John Dewey's Artwork as Practical experience, determined by the William James lectures he delivered at Harvard College, was an make an effort to exhibit the integrity of artwork, society and day-to-day encounter (IEP). Artwork, for Dewey, is or really should be a Element of Everybody's Inventive life and not only the privilege of the pick out team of artists. He also emphasizes which the viewers is greater than a passive recipient. Dewey's procedure of artwork was a move faraway from the transcendental method of aesthetics in the wake of Immanuel Kant who emphasised the distinctive character of artwork plus the disinterested character of aesthetic appreciation.

Peirce produced the concept inquiry is dependent upon true doubt, not mere verbal or hyperbolic doubt,[ten] and claimed that, to be able to know a conception within a fruitful way, "Look at the sensible consequences with the objects of your conception. Then, your conception of People consequences is The complete within your conception of the item",[1] which he afterwards called the pragmatic maxim. It equates any conception of an object to the overall extent of your conceivable implications for informed observe of that item's consequences.

James and Dewey had been empirical thinkers in probably the most easy style: practical experience is the last word test and expertise is exactly what should be described. They ended up dissatisfied with everyday empiricism since, from the custom courting from Hume, empiricists experienced an inclination to think about practical experience as nothing in excess of person sensations.
